Owens Corning Roofing Partners With CCN

Certified Contractors Network to assist with practices, systems, and processes for scaling contractors’ businesses

Owens Corning said it has partnered with the Certified Contractors Network to help roofing and home improvement contractors scale their businesses and drive sustainable growth. 

The CCN Partnership is exclusive to Owens Corning Roofing Contractor Network members, including one-on-one coaching, member roundtable discussions, and targeted training to drive continuous improvement across the contractor’s business. 

Tailored to the roofing and home improvement industry, the CCN Partnership delivers best-in-class coaching designed to help improve performance in critical areas, including business planning, operations, financial statements, sales management, marketing and more. 

The partnership, announced in an August 13 news release, provides OCCN members with unlimited access to a full-course curriculum at a deeply subsidized rate – 60% off the list price for the first year of membership. 

OC said curriculum modules may help members transform their businesses by improving systems and processes. Content addresses macro-issues, like lead generation, as well as specific functions like scheduling protocols and checklists. 

CCN Vice President Gary Cohen said that CCN helps contractors implement proven systems and processes designed to achieve revenue and net profit results. 

“Many members joined CCN with modest revenues and, by fully engaging in our proven processes, have achieved robust sales with net profits of 15% to 20 %,” he said. 

Cohen added that CCN emphasizes frequency and continuous improvement through a strategy that leverages coaching to keep members engaged. 

“We are thrilled about our partnership with Owens Corning. Our goal is to help Owens Corning Roofing Contractor Network members achieve measurable results in the first 90 days; we systematically tackle each area of the business to further improve performance,” Cohen said. 

Jon Gardner, marketing leader, Learning and Development at Owens Corning, said, “Today’s roofing and home improvement contractor understands that investing in the health and sustainability of the business is critical to its success; we see this throughout the OCCN network.” 

The CCN Partnership Program provides members with access to digital roundtable discussions and limited tickets to three annual conferences. The full-course curriculum also includes the National Association of the Remodeling Industry boot camps.
